Poor Doors campaigners burn Boris
London mayor effigy up in flames as activists highlight segregated housing disgrace

CAMPAIGNERS burnt an effigy of the London Mayor for Bonfire Night in protest against social segregation in the capital.

The torching of Boris Johnson was part of the Poor Doors campaign, which has been targeting a newly built housing complex in east london.

The skyscraper has caused controversy because its “affordable” flats are only accessible through a door at the rear of the building.
